AN ACT to amend the election law, in relation to the location of polling
sites for early voting in certain cities and towns
TH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M-
B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S:
Section 1. Paragraph (d) of subdivision 2 of section 8-600 of the
election law, as added by chapter 6 of the laws of 2019, is amended to
read as follows:
(d) Polling places for early voting shall be located so that voters in
the county have adequate and equitable access, taking into consideration
population density, travel time to the polling place, proximity to other
early voting poll sites, public transportation routes, commuter traffic
patterns and such other factors the board of elections deems
appropriate; PROVIDED, HOWEVER, THAT IN CITIES AND TOWNS WITH A POPU-
LATION OF MORE THAN FIFTY THOUSAND BUT LESS THAN ONE HUNDRED THOUSAND
BASED ON THE LATEST FEDERAL DECENNIAL CENSUS, EACH SUCH CITY AND TOWN
MUST HAVE AT LEAST ONE EARLY VOTING POLLING PLACE WITHIN ITS BOUNDARIES,
AND, TO THE EXTENT PRACTICABLE, IF SUCH CITIES OR TOWNS HAVE PUBLIC
TRANSPORTATION ROUTES, SUCH POLLING PLACE SHALL BE SITUATED ALONG SUCH
TRANSPORTATION ROUTES. The provisions of section 4-104 of this chapter,
except subdivisions four and five of such section, shall apply to the
designation of polling places for early voting except to the extent such
provisions are inconsistent with this section.
§ 2. This act shall take effect immediately.
